Output 8ea84920d321f0cde632f7b5d2d2bc354fb0b8946fcd6ca5db117e6bed915620:0

value
5119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cebc5aaa57aaa62debc6670710363e832f6c480 OP_EQUAL
address
3JuwQLr9EZvKgcrtzquxHsq4aFyN7L7Ues
transaction
8ea84920d321f0cde632f7b5d2d2bc354fb0b8946fcd6ca5db117e6bed915620
confirmations
46098
spent
true